Question Answer
What muscles are innervated by the ansa cervicalis? Omohyoid, sternothyroid and sternohyoid
What is the innervation of cricothyroid? External laryngeal nerve (from superior laryngeal nerve - from inferior vagal ganglion CN X)
What muscles are supplied by the inferior laryngeal nerve (from recurrent laryngeal nerve)? Thyro-arytenoid, posterior and lateral crico-arytenoids, transverse and oblique arytenoids and vocalis
What muscles are supplied by the pharyngeal branch of the vagus (from inferior vagal ganglion)? Pharyngeal constrictor muscles, palatopharyngeus, stylopharyngeus and salpingopharyngeus, musculus uvulae, levator veli palatini
